>>30492948
Still a great plane, but the F-16 MLUs are getting old. The airframes don't have much flight time left and the avionics are getting outdated.
The Netherlands has the same F-16 and they couldn't operate their F-16s in Syria because the F-16 MLUs lack satellite comms.

Tbh I am curious how Denmark (and also Belgium) are going to work with the fact that they have to wait like 10 years before they'll receive F-35s in operational condition to replace their F-16 fleet, which probably doesn't have much flight hours left. They're so late to the F-35 party that they probably haven't even seen the inside of one, yet most other countries who ordered the F-35 are already testing the plane and/or training pilots and maintenance crew.

>>30488857
No, all the Danish gov could agree on is how much they could spend on the new fighters and to try to get at least 21 of them. That 27 is as of now just a wishful up-to-number if the agreed budget allows them to get that many. The thing is however, even getting 21 is not that certain at this point because unlike EF and Boeing that submitted a binding offers, LM opted not to which has put the Danes in a peculiar situation where they have already ranked F-35 to be the cheapest fighter in the """"competition"""" but they don't know how much each plane and associated gear needed to operate them is actually going to cost

>>30493422
>The airframes don't have much flight time left and the avionics are getting outdated.

Is there an absolute limit to the duration a single airframe can be kept airworthy with an unlimited budget? Is there a point where the frame itself is too worn?
>>
>>30503427
Well, you could probably do total overhauls that extend it another few thousand hours, but it'll be way more expensive each time. Fighters are race cars to a Cessna's Honda Civic.
>>
>>30503427
>Is there a point where the frame itself is too worn?

Yes. While you can take out an engine and replace it easily once its gone past its servicable life, airframes gain stress shearing and fractures that would eventually make them too dangerous to fly.

This happens faster if you're flying them under high G loads.
